WebShelf life is also reduced, and the carcase devalued. This is usually caused by stress in the 24–48 hours before slaughter. To avoid stress: Always handle animals quietly. Avoid mixing cattle from different groups. Provide clean, dry bedding and plenty of water in any holding pens or lairage. WebApr 10, 2024 · Available forage of 216 AUMs is divided by 8.5 AUMs per pair to get the stocking rate of 25 cow-calf pairs for the five months of grazing season in this example. This is figured for continuously grazing that pasture, so if the pasture is rotational grazed, it would give you a different situation, Laborie says. WebJun 1, 2024 · Bulls (1,800 lb) will be with the cows for a 60-day breeding season at a ratio of one bull to 25 cows. Calculate the bull demand and add to the cow-calf demand. 1,800 ÷ 1,000 = 1.8 AUM × 2 months (60-day breeding season) = 3.6 AUM for 1 bull. Divide total AUM available by the AUM needed for each pair for the 5-month growing season.
